Transaction e77836f3fe95fa993a95359ed5dbc4fb75d2e93ac653570c8f27463d4dbf0175

95 Input
2 Outputs
  • e77836f3fe95fa993a95359ed5dbc4fb75d2e93ac653570c8f27463d4dbf0175:0
  • value  500000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e77836f3fe95fa993a95359ed5dbc4fb75d2e93ac653570c8f27463d4dbf0175:1
  • value  4625157
    address  128MqqxQ4tEVGLMmQq2H7xyP7CMND8vyAP